Abstract

The synthesis and characterization of a bis(2-dimethylaminothien-5-yl)curcumin boron difluoride chromophore is presented. Photophysical, electrochemical and computational investigations establish the properties of its absorption in the Vis-NIR spectral range relative to established curcumin dyes. Application of this thienyl curcumin dye as a photoacoustic contrast agent is investigated against the dicarbocyanine Cy5 dye in the 675-735 nm excitation range.
